Gettysburg 150th Reenactment Trailer

On June 27-30, 2013, over ten thousand reenactors assembled in Gettysburg, Pennsylvania to commemorate one of the most important battles of the Civil War. They came from all over the country and recreated some of the most dramatic parts of the battle. Join us in this video to relive these exciting battles.
